2026 Supreme(Online)(CAT) 1088

CENTRAL ADMINISTRATIVE TRIBUNAL
Rajinder Singh Dogra, Judicial Member
Sham Lal – Appellant
Versus
Union Territory of Jammu and Kashmir – Respondent


Advocates:
For the Appellants/Petitioners: Mr. Syed Nadeem Hamdani
For the Respondents: Mr. Rajesh Thapa, ld. A.A.G., Mr. Hunar Gupta, DAG, Mr. Akshay Sadotra

Table of Content
1. applicants claim interest on delayed retiral benefits. (Para 1 , 2)
2. respondents deny deliberate delay due to pay corrections. (Para 3)
3. delay justified by pay fixation errors and revisions. (Para 4 , 5 , 6 , 7)
4. no automatic interest right; claim not sustainable. (Para 8 , 9 , 10 , 11)
5. application dismissed, no interference warranted. (Para 12 , 13)

ORDER

Per: - Rajinder Singh Dogra, Judicial Member

1. The applicants have filed the present Original Application under Section 19 of the Administrative Tribunals Act, 1985 seeking the following reliefs: -

“In view of the facts mentioned in Para 4 above, the applicants pray for the following reliefs:

i/ Set Aside/Quash the order No. PHERM/2229-31 dated 30.12.2024 passed by the respondents.

ii/ directions to the respondents to declared the applicants entitled to cash payment @18% interest p.a legitimately due to them on release of retiral benefits including the gratuity and pension with effect from the date of retirement till its realization as per Regulation 242 of Civil Service Regulations, 1956 Vol-1

iii/ any other relief which this Hon'ble tribunal may deems fit or proper in the facts and circumstances of the case.”
